First Aid, Pt 1 - Major Wounds And Fractures

Duration: 33 min

Year Published: 1957

Creator: The Pentagon

Format: 16mm

Color: Color

Sound: sound

Description: Describes first aid procedures in treating wounds of the chest, belly, head and face, including application of elementary and improvised pressure dressings and the use of a tourniquet to stop uncontrolled bleeding. Demonstrates procedures used in treating fractures of the jaw, leg, elbow, arm, ribs, neck and back, including proper splinting, the use of a sling for arm fractures and the handling of victims with rib, neck and back fractures.
